Warwick Wine Estate
Situated in the sublime wine sanctuary of Stellenbosch the Warwick Wine Estate was originally known as “De Goede Sukses” from 1771 to 1902. Bought by Colonel William Alexander Gordon after the Anglo Boer War, he renamed it after his regiment, Warwickshire. In 1964 it was bought once again by Sam Ratcliffe. He had been searching the perfect wine terrain and found it in Warwick’s grounds.
The original vineyard planted was that of Cabernet Sauvignon and high quality grapes were produced. In 1984 the first official Warwick vintage was released and received with praise by the critics. In 1986 a Bordeaux blend, Warwick Trilogy, was released and has since become an emblem of the fine wines of the South African Wine Industry
Current Activities of Warwick Wine Estate
Presently, aside from producing beautiful wine, the Warwick Wine Estate hosts activities which provide the perfect opportunity for wine drinking. The Warwick Wine Estate has a first class picnic experience whereby outing can be arranged at several locations on their land. Surrounded by the beauty of the Cape a lunching on gourmet food and wine baskets, by Warwick Wine Estates of course, makes a gorgeous day outing.
Alternatively there is the Big 5 Wine Safari experience offered by the Warwick Wine Estate. Guests are taken on a tour of Warwick Wine Estate’s vineyards and given real 4×4 experience while learning about the Big 5 of wine grapes.
The Warwick Wine Estate has a kids’ play area that is sealed off to ensure the safety of your children if they wish to gallivant with their friends
